Mobility goes far beyond flexibility. It integrates strength, coordination, agility, neuromuscular connection, and intra-articular fluid circulation: a true health cocktail! It’s the ability to move freely, dynamically, overcoming both physical and psychological constraints. Unlike passive stretching, mobility engages the entire muscular chain, where strength becomes a key development element.
